Continuing, first reported by David Matevosian on May 23rd. Followed David's instructions and found the bird singing above the flat part of the wooded trail below the cliffs, just before the trail drops down north towards Dry Brook. Very cooperative compared to other Acadian Flycatchers I've seen in the valley singing openly on dead branches for extended periods. Some audio attached including the wispy 'twitter song' which it gave in flight. Thanks to David for his report.
